def sanitize_yaml (frontmatter):
"""
Escapes any occurences of double quotes
in any of the frontmatter fields
See: https://docs.octoprint.org/en/master/configuration/yaml.html#interesting-data-types
"""
for k, v in frontmatter.items():
if type(v) == type([]):
#some fields are lists
l = []
for i in v:
i = sub('"', '\\"', i)
l.append(i)
frontmatter[k] = l
else:
v = sub('"', '\\"', v)
frontmatter[k] = v
return frontmatter
